What Does Casual Cocktail Attire Actually Mean?

Casual cocktail attire means dressing polished but relaxed, somewhere between formal cocktail wear and everyday casual clothing. You are aiming for a look that feels put together without a tie, a full suit, or anything overly stiff.

Casual Cocktail Attire vs Cocktail Attire: What Is The Difference?

People mix these two up constantly, so let us clear it up right away.

Dress CodeFormality LevelTypical Pieces
Cocktail AttireHighSuit and tie, cocktail dress, heels
Casual Cocktail AttireMediumBlazer with chinos, midi dress, loafers
Business CasualMedium LowButton down, dress pants, no blazer required
Smart CasualLow MediumNice jeans, polo or blouse, clean sneakers

Casual cocktail attire sits in the middle of that scale. It skips the strict formality of a tuxedo or a full length gown but still expects effort. Think elevated, not sloppy.Source:generationtux

Casual Cocktail Attire For Women

Women have a lot of flexibility here, which is great, but it can also feel overwhelming.

What To Wear

  • A knee length or midi dress in a nice fabric like silk, crepe, or satin
  • A dressy jumpsuit with statement earrings
  • A silky blouse paired with tailored trousers
  • A skirt and top combo in a bold color or subtle print
  • Block heels, wedges, or polished flats

What To Avoid

  • Beach sandals or flip flops
  • Distressed denim
  • Gym wear or athleisure
  • Overly casual t shirts

A good rule I always share with friends is this. If you would wear it to a picnic, it is too casual. If you would wear it to a black tie gala, it is too formal. Casual cocktail attire lives right in the middle.

Casual Cocktail Attire For Men

Men often think this dress code means “just wear a suit,” but that actually overshoots the mark.

What To Wear

  • A blazer paired with chinos or dark denim
  • A button down shirt, tucked in, sleeves optional
  • Loafers or clean leather sneakers
  • A simple watch or subtle accessory

What To Avoid

  • Full three piece suits
  • Sneakers with visible logos or sports branding
  • Shorts, even on hot days
  • Graphic tees

Fabric And Color Choices That Work Every Time

Fabric choice makes or breaks a casual cocktail look. Stick to fabrics with a slight sheen or structure, such as linen blends, crepe, or lightweight wool. Avoid anything too textured or overly casual like heavy cotton fleece.

For colors, neutral tones like navy, black, burgundy, and olive always photograph well and pair easily with accessories. Bright jewel tones like emerald or sapphire also work beautifully for evening events.

Seasonal Tips For Casual Cocktail Attire

Weather changes everything about how an outfit feels and looks.

Summer

Choose breathable fabrics like linen or lightweight cotton blends. Light colors like blush, sage, or soft blue keep you cool while staying elegant.

Winter

Layer with a tailored coat or a structured blazer. Darker tones like deep plum, charcoal, or forest green feel seasonally appropriate.

Fall

Earthy tones like rust, mustard, and chocolate brown work wonderfully. A light trench coat over your outfit adds polish without bulk.

Common Mistakes People Make With Casual Cocktail Attire

I have made a few of these mistakes myself, so trust me, they happen easily.

  1. Wearing something too formal, like a full tuxedo, which can make hosts feel like you misunderstood the invite.
  2. Wearing something too casual, like sneakers with a graphic logo, which can feel disrespectful at a nicer event.
  3. Ignoring the venue. A garden party calls for different footwear than a hotel ballroom.
  4. Forgetting accessories. A great blazer or dress can fall flat without a nice bag, watch, or jewelry.
  5. Overpacking on trends. Stick to timeless pieces so your outfit photographs well for years to come.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is casual cocktail attire for a wedding? For a wedding, casual cocktail attire usually means a midi dress or jumpsuit for women and a blazer with chinos for men. Avoid anything too casual like shorts or sandals.

Can I wear jeans for casual cocktail attire? Dark, well fitted jeans can work if paired with a blazer and dressy shoes, but lighter or distressed denim should be avoided.

Is casual cocktail attire the same as smart casual? No. Casual cocktail attire is slightly more polished than smart casual and usually includes at least one elevated piece like a blazer or dressy top.

Can men wear a suit for casual cocktail attire? A full suit can feel overdressed for this code. A blazer with chinos or dark denim is a safer, more balanced choice.

What shoes work best for casual cocktail attire? Loafers, block heels, wedges, and polished flats all work well. Avoid sneakers with logos, flip flops, or heavy boots.

Is a cocktail dress required for casual cocktail attire? Not necessarily. A midi dress, jumpsuit, or skirt and blouse combination all fit within this dress code.

What colors work best for casual cocktail attire? Neutral tones like navy, black, and olive work year round. Jewel tones like emerald and sapphire also look elegant for evening events.

Can I wear a t shirt for casual cocktail attire? A plain, well fitted t shirt under a blazer can work for very relaxed events, but graphic tees should always be avoided.
